Job Closed

This listing is no longer active.

Reveal Technology logo
Reveal Technology

Actionable intelligence at the tactical edge

Senior Backend Engineer

Backend EngineerSoftware EngineerOtherRemoteSeniorTeam 11-50H1B No SponsorCompany SiteLinkedIn

Location

United States

Posted

130 days ago

Salary

$150K - $185K / year

Seniority

Senior

Bachelor Degree8 yrs expEnglishDockerKubernetesPostgreSQLRubyRuby on RailsSQL

Job Description

Senior Backend Engineer

Reveal Technology

• Design, build, and maintain scalable APIs using Ruby on Rails, supporting mobile, desktop and web clients with a focus on performance, reliability, and maintainability • Containerize applications and supporting services using Docker and supported deployment workflows for consistent environments across development, staging, and production • Lead database design and management efforts, including schema design, data modeling, query optimization, migrations, and performance tuning in PostgreSQL • Maintain DevOps and CI/CD pipelines, improving build automation, test reliability, and deployment processes to increase developer velocity and system stability • Ensure security and compliance requirements are met by implementing secure coding practices, authentication and authorization controls, encryption strategies, and vulnerability mitigation • Work across the team and specialties to drive quality through architecture, code review, and collaborative development. • Assist our business development and mission success teams with troubleshooting and technical issues

Job Requirements

  • 8+ years of experience in Backend development
  • Expertise in Ruby and SQL, including designing backend architectures, building scalable services, and optimizing complex database queries
  • Deep understanding of security architecture and cryptography, including key management, threat modeling, secure system design, and defending against common attack vectors.
  • Strong experience using Docker and Kubernetes to containerize applications, manage deployments, configure services, and operate production workloads
  • Deep expertise with PostgreSQL, including advanced data modeling, query optimization, indexing strategies, transaction management, and operating production databases at scale
  • Can manage your own productivity in an asynchronous, fully remote environmentWillingness to learn new technologies and tools as needed, and to read and refactor code to make it better, even if it's not your own

Benefits

  • Medical, Dental, Vision coverage
  • HSA/FSA options
  • Parental Leave
  • 401(k): 100% match for the first 6% contributed
  • Unlimited Paid Time Off
  • Home Office Stipend

Related Job Pages

More Backend Engineer Jobs

Full TimeRemoteTeam 11-50H1B Sponsor

• Shape and work on product features in a collaborative, small team • Help maintain and develop system with NestJS, Prisma, React, and PostgreSQL • Manage core infrastructure like CI/CD pipelines and serverless GCP setup • Collaborate with Product and Design to shape projects and lead them to completion • Propose and challenge software architectural decisions and engineering processes • Coach team members, guide them on product and software decisions, and maintain code quality • Advocate security best practices and identify potential risks

Germany
Job Closed
GR8 Tech logo

Senior .Net Developer – Navigation Widgets

GR8 Tech

Launch, grow, or upgrade your iGaming business with GR8 Tech high-performance Sportsbook and iGaming platform.

Backend Engineer130 days ago
OtherRemoteTeam 501-1,000H1B No Sponsor

• Develop and maintain CRM solutions for the Navigation Widgets team. • Deliver high-quality features and ensure system stability. • Collaborate across cross-functional teams.

United States
Job Closed
OtherRemoteTeam 201-500H1B No Sponsor

• As a Senior Engineer at Nearform your main task will be designing & building applications using Python. However as you’ll likely work on a variety of projects your responsibilities may also include: • Supporting component design, development and maintenance and taking responsibility for personal technical quality standards within the project team. • Assisting with defining structured practices, especially in source code management, building and deployment. • Designing and implementing data storage solutions. • Optimising performance in applications for maximum speed and scalability. • Getting feedback from users and clients, and building solutions for them. • Assisting with the analysis of client requirements. • Working with and supporting Technical Leaders in project execution and timely delivery. • Collaborating with client teams.

United States
401K / year
Lean Tech logo

Senior Backend Engineer

Lean Tech

We build the most efficient software development teams across Latin America.

Backend Engineer130 days ago
Full TimeRemoteTeam 501-1,000H1B No Sponsor

• Design and implement scalable, event-driven backend integration services using Kafka. • Contribute to architectural decisions and drive best practices. • Develop and maintain robust backend services using F#. • Design and evolve RESTful and gRPC APIs. • Collaborate with cross-functional teams to align integration services. • Maintain operational awareness across infrastructure, CI/CD pipelines, and application layers.

Colombia
Job Closed